Here's my fave Speccy Games.


10. Fairlight. This spawned the adventure genre. Along with Head Over Heels this game revolutionised gaming.




9. Turbo Esprit. The great great grandfather of Grand Theft Auto. I used to love this game back in the day.



8. Gunfright. Forget Red Dead Redemption, this is the ultimate Western game!




7. BMX Simulator, Used to spend hours racing my mate around these courses, both bashing our little fingers on the poor rubber keys!



6. Bruce Lee. Another great action fighter back in the day. I must have completed this about 30 times!



5. Fued, A brilliant spellcasting game I used to spend literally hours when I bought it for I belive, £2.99!



4. 3D Stock Car Championship. The greatest racing game ever made! To this day remains my favourite two player game of all time. My best mate and used to play complete seasons on this! To my mind the handling of the cars in this game was never bettered. Even the computer controlled cars were brilliant. Fucking loved this game!



3. COMMANDO, imo the greatest army game EVER! Fucking brilliant even to this day watching the demo it looks ace. This game was soooooo cool.



2. Lords of Midnight. Shamefully I'm having to link to a Comodore 64 clip as there are no Speccy clips that I can find. I think this game was what made me a fantasy, strategy type chess loving hobbity nerd. Massing my armies under the banner of Luxor the Moonprince, (who I like to think was King of the Jews) we'd march against the Doomsdark's evil hordes. Was a great game.




1, Carrier Command. I believe this is the most advanced Speccy game ever created. Like a Battlefield type game 20 years before its time. You could fly planes, boats, strategise, it was ace! So advanced they couldn't even fit in sound effects and you used to play an included cassete tape of music over and over for sound! Unfortunately I can't find a speccy clip so I provide this, probably better Commodore 64 version.
